How many hybrid energy storage projects are there in Poland?

Development of approx. 20 hybrid energy storage projects with a capacity of over 500 MW. Development of an energy storage project at the Kraków CHP plant with a capacity of approx. 90 MW. Analysis of the possibility of using energy storage facilities to support the reliable and safe supply of green energy to the Polish railways.

Is Poland a key player in Europe's energy storage sector?

Poland is emerging as a significant player in Europe's energy storage sector. The recent capacity market auctions in December 2024 highlighted a substantial shift towards BESS, with approximately 2.5 GW secured by new generation capacity market units, predominantly Li-ion energy storage projects.

How much will Poland invest in energy by 2040?

Total required investments in Poland’s energy sector could reach USD 420 billion (PLN 1.6 trillion) by 2040. USD 84-89 billion (PLN 320-340 billion) is expected for electricity generation alone, with 80% of that allocated to emission-free sources (RES and nuclear power).
